A mocker resents correction; he will not consult the wise. Proverbs 15:12 (NIV) 

Receptive

How receptive are you to receiving my correction? That sounds like an easy question to answer. Really? You might want to think a little more deeply, if you think that this is an easy question for you to answer. Why is that? Would you like me to ask you some related questions? I’m not sure, but go ahead, I’m listening. That’s good. How much of a risk would it be for some to give you some strong words of correction? Before you answer let me also ask you how often has someone taken the risk to offer you some strong words of correction. To your second question, I would say that it has been seldom, if ever, that someone has given me some strong words of correction. Why is that? Is it because you have never needed any strong words of correction? I doubt that. I’m sure that there have been many times that I could have used some strong words of correction in my life. That’s true. How do you think you might react if someone were to give you some strong words of correction? I might react negatively. I might become defensive. I might even become combative. Are you sure? No, I am not sure. Why is that? Recently, I have found myself inviting others to give me words of correction if they felt that I needed them. That’s good. You will never receive needful and helpful words of correction if you give off signals that you would react negatively and probably wouldn’t receive them anyway. Be unwilling to receive correction and wisdom is a very foolish and dangerous position to be in.  It is a very wise person that gives permission to others to give them words of correction whenever they need them. So, keep on asking others to speak words of wisdom and correction into your life. Yes Lord, I will.

How will you receive correction and wisdom from me? It is the desire of my heart to know and do your will. I want to do what is pleasing in your sight. So, I will listen attentively to all that you want to say to me. I will ask for your wisdom. I will hear your instructions and follow your direction. I will welcome your correction in my life. I will allow you to mold and shape me into the person you want me to become. I will follow you to wherever you lead me. I will do whatever you ask of me. I will allow you to change my heart, transform my mind and guide my life as I follow you. That will be very good. 

Lord, I will not be stubborn and proud. I will allow myself to receive correction. I will listen to whatever you say to me. I need wisdom from you. I need wisdom from those you place in my life. I will change my thoughts, words and deeds as you give me wisdom. Amen
